We bought a LCD TV just before the announcement of HD. Will there be a box available to convert the picture to HD after release, just like the sky box for example, or do we have to purchase another TV.

if you are saying that your tv is not hd ready then no you cannot receive hd signal at all.
The only means of viewing HD at present are via a Sky or Cable HD box....or a HD DVD player.
There are no Freeview HD boxes at the moment and unlikely to be until after the analogue TV switch-off in around 4-5 yrs time.
As Mattk says, if your TV is not HD ready, then there is no way via any kind of add-on that you can watch HDTV. It's just not physically possible, in the same way that you can't view a colour picture on a monochrome TV
